Introdução Geral #
O sinalizador B002 é equipado com um sensor de aceleração de três eixos que detecta se ele está em movimento. Ele pode alternar entre dois modos de publicidade diferentes ( Modo Periódico e Modo Autônomo) alterando o Limiar do acelerômetro valor. Ele também suporta a detecção e a divulgação do nível da bateria. No modo autônomo, ele pode anunciar a cada 24 horas se não for movido.

Especificações do produto #
Tabela 1: Especificações do produto
| Protocolo | iBeacon |
| Potência de RF | 0dBm in default, -20 to +5dBm Potência TX |
| Distância | Máx. 80m |
| Densidade para rastreamento interno | >10m |
| Radiodifusão | Mínimo 100 ms |
| Acelerômetro | Opcional |
| Consumo de energia | With acceleration sensor: 5μA @ 5s interval and 0dBm Potência TX |
| Without acceleration sensor: 4.2μA @ 5s interval and 0dBm Potência TX | |
| Bateria | Li-MnO2, 500mAh |
| Peso | 10g |
| Dimensão | 90 mm * 60 mm * 1,5 mm, Espessura: 1,5 ~ 2,5 mm. 68 mm * 60 mm * 2 mm, Espessura: 1,5 ~ 3,5 mm. |
| Certificação | FCCID: 2APPL-100-0B, CE |
Descrição da função #
Status ligado/desligado #
- Ligar: Pressione o botão por 3s e a luz vermelha piscará por um minuto.
- Desligar: Pressione o botão por 3s e nenhuma luz piscará.

Potência TX #
A intensidade do sinal enviado pelo beacon. O valor padrão é 06 (0dBm).
Table 2: Potência TX
| Tipo de valor | Valor | Potência TX (dBm) |
| Hex | 01 | -20 |
| 02 | -16 | |
| 03 | -12 | |
| 04 | -8 | |
| 05 | -4 | |
| 06 | 0 | |
| 07 | 4 |
Intervalo de anúncio #
O intervalo de anúncio do beacon é de 5 s por padrão, o que significa que o beacon anuncia o pacote de publicidade uma vez a cada 5 s. O intervalo máximo de anúncio é de 10 s.
Tabela 3: Intervalo de anúncio
| Tipo de valor | Valor | EUintervalo (ms) |
| Hex | 01000000 | 100 |
| 02000000 | 200 | |
| 03000000 | 300 | |
| 04000000 | 400 | |
| 05000000 | 500 | |
| … | … | |
| 64000000 | 10,000 |
Limiar do acelerômetro #
O valor limite do acelerômetro é 0x00 por padrão, o que significa que o modo autônomo está desabilitado e o beacon anuncia no Modo periódico. Quando o valor limite do acelerômetro for maior ou igual a 0x10, o beacon anuncia no Modo Autônomo. O farol é considerado em movimento quando a velocidade acelerada é maior que o limite. A unidade padrão é 16 mg, Limite do acelerômetro = valor * 16 mg.
Tabela 4: Limiar do Acelerômetro
| Tipo de valor | Valor | Limiar (mg) |
| Hex | 00 | 00 significa que o modo periódico está ativado. |
| 01 ~ 0F | Reservado para uso futuro. | |
| 10 | 256 (0x10 = 16, 16x16mg = 256mg)Modo Autônomo | |
| 11 | 272(0x11 = 17, 17x16mg = 272mg) | |
| 12 | 288 | |
| 13 | 304 | |
| … | … | |
| 7F | 2032 |
Modo de anúncio #
Modo Periódico #
No modo periódico, o beacon anuncia o pacote de publicidade em intervalos fixos, conforme configurado, até que a bateria acabe.
Modo Autônomo #
No modo autônomo, o beacon só anuncia quando está em movimento. Quando a aceleração é maior que o limite do acelerômetro, o beacon anuncia com o Anunciar Intervalo valor para a duração do Tempo de anúncio.
Por exemplo, se o valor do intervalo for 5s e o tempo de anúncio for 1min, o beacon não anunciará se estiver parado. Quando a aceleração for maior que o limite do acelerômetro, o beacon anunciará uma vez a cada 5s e continuará anunciando por 1min.
Tempo de anúncio #
A duração padrão do anúncio do beacon é 0000, e o tempo máximo de anúncio é 65535s. Esta configuração funciona apenas no modo autônomo. Se o beacon funcionar no modo periódico, esta configuração não terá efeito.
Tabela 5: Tempo de anúncio
| Tipo de valor | Valor | Tempo (s) |
| Hex | 0000 | Transmita o tempo todo. |
| 0001 ~ 001D | Reservado para uso futuro. | |
| 001E | 30 | |
| 001F | 31 | |
| 0020 | 32 | |
| … | … | |
| FFFF | 65535 |
Configuração do switch #
O sinalizador B002 possui duas funções de comutação: "Aviso de Nível de Bateria" e "Aviso de Sem Movimento 24h". A função "Aviso de Nível de Bateria" determina se o sinalizador anuncia com o nível da bateria. A função "Aviso de Sem Movimento 24h" determina se o sinalizador anuncia a cada 24 horas se não for movido.
Tabela 6: Configuração do switch
| Name | Valor | Ddescrição |
| Anúncio de nível de bateria | 00:desativado, 01:ativado, o valor padrão é 0. | Esta configuração determina se o beacon anuncia o nível da bateria. |
| Nenhum movimento 24h Anúncio | 00:desativado, 01:ativado, o valor padrão é 0. | Esta configuração só funciona no modo autônomo, onde o beacon anuncia a cada 24 horas se não for movido. No modo periódico, esta configuração não tem efeito. |
Recurso de publicidade #
Em Modo Periódico, o beacon anuncia um pacote de 30 bytes com 5s fixos Intervalo de anúncio. Em Modo Autônomo, o beacon só anuncia com o valor do intervalo de anúncio durante o período de Tempo de anúncio quando estiver em movimento e não emitirá nenhum sinal quando estiver parado.
O pacote de publicidade do beacon é o seguinte.
Pacote de publicidade padrão #
O beacon anuncia um pacote de publicidade padrão quando o recurso de nível de bateria não está habilitado.
Tabela 7. Pacote de publicidade iBeacon padrão
| Deslocamento de bytes | Valor padrão | Descrição | Propriedades |
| 0 | 0x02 | Comprimento dos dados – 2 bytes | Preâmbulo constante |
| 1 | 0x01 | Tipo de dados – sinalizadores | Preâmbulo constante |
| 2 | 0x06 | Bandeira LE e BR/EDR | Preâmbulo constante |
| 3 | 0x1A | Comprimento dos dados – 26 bytes | Preâmbulo constante |
| 4 | 0xFF | Tipo de dados – Dados específicos do fabricante | Preâmbulo constante |
| 5 | 0x4C | Dados do fabricante | Preâmbulo constante |
| 6 | 0x00 | Dados do fabricante | Preâmbulo constante |
| 7 | 0x02 | Dados do fabricante | Preâmbulo constante |
| 8 | 0x15 | Dados do fabricante | Preâmbulo constante |
| 9 | 0xF2 | UUID de proximidade 1º byte | UUID do usuário |
| 10 | 0xA5 | UUID de proximidade 2º byte | UUID do usuário |
| 11 | 0x2D | UUID de proximidade 3º byte | UUID do usuário |
| 12 | 0x43 | UUID de proximidade 4º byte | UUID do usuário |
| 13 | 0xE0 | UUID de proximidade 5º byte | UUID do usuário |
| 14 | 0xAB | UUID de proximidade 6º byte | UUID do usuário |
| 15 | 0x48 | UUID de proximidade 7º byte | UUID do usuário |
| 16 | 0x9C | UUID de proximidade 8º byte | UUID do usuário |
| 17 | 0xB6 | UUID de proximidade 9º byte | UUID do usuário |
| 18 | 0x4C | UUID de proximidade 10º byte | UUID do usuário |
| 19 | 0x4A | UUID de proximidade 11º byte | UUID do usuário |
| 20 | 0x83 | UUID de proximidade 12º byte | UUID do usuário |
| 21 | 0x00 | UUID de proximidade 13º byte | UUID do usuário |
| 22 | 0x14 | UUID de proximidade 14º byte | UUID do usuário |
| 23 | 0x67 | UUID de proximidade 15º byte | UUID do usuário |
| 24 | 0x20 | UUID de proximidade 16º byte | UUID do usuário |
| 25 | AA | 1º byte principal | Valor principal |
| 26 | BB | 2º byte principal | Valor principal |
| 27 | CC | 1º byte menor | Valor menor |
| 28 | CC | 2º byte menor | Valor menor |
| 29 | 0xB3 | Potência do sinal (SSI calibrado a 1 m) | Valor da potência do sinal |
Pacote de publicidade com nível de bateria #
O beacon também suporta a publicidade de informações sobre o nível da bateria no último byte. Capítulo 5.2 Configuração de anúncio de nível de bateria explica como habilitar esse recurso via “LightBlue”.
Tabela 8: Pacote de publicidade com nível de bateria
| Deslocamento de bytes | Valor padrão | Descrição | Propriedades |
| 0 | 0x02 | Comprimento dos dados – 2 bytes | Preâmbulo constante |
| 1 | 0x01 | Tipo de dados – sinalizadores | Preâmbulo constante |
| 2 | 0x06 | Bandeira LE e BR/EDR | Preâmbulo constante |
| 3 | 0x1B | Comprimento dos dados – 27 bytes | Preâmbulo constante |
| 4 | 0xFF | Tipo de dados – Dados específicos do fabricante | Preâmbulo constante |
| 5 | 0x4C | Dados do fabricante | Preâmbulo constante |
| 6 | 0x00 | Dados do fabricante | Preâmbulo constante |
| 7 | 0x02 | Dados do fabricante | Preâmbulo constante |
| 8 | 0x15 | Dados do fabricante | Preâmbulo constante |
| 9 | 0xF2 | UUID de proximidade 1º byte | UUID do usuário |
| 10 | 0xA5 | UUID de proximidade 2º byte | UUID do usuário |
| 11 | 0x2D | UUID de proximidade 3º byte | UUID do usuário |
| 12 | 0x43 | UUID de proximidade 4º byte | UUID do usuário |
| 13 | 0xE0 | UUID de proximidade 5º byte | UUID do usuário |
| 14 | 0xAB | UUID de proximidade 6º byte | UUID do usuário |
| 15 | 0x48 | UUID de proximidade 7º byte | UUID do usuário |
| 16 | 0x9C | UUID de proximidade 8º byte | UUID do usuário |
| 17 | 0xB6 | UUID de proximidade 9º byte | UUID do usuário |
| 18 | 0x4C | UUID de proximidade 10º byte | UUID do usuário |
| 19 | 0x4A | UUID de proximidade 11º byte | UUID do usuário |
| 20 | 0x83 | UUID de proximidade 12º byte | UUID do usuário |
| 21 | 0x00 | UUID de proximidade 13º byte | UUID do usuário |
| 22 | 0x14 | UUID de proximidade 14º byte | UUID do usuário |
| 23 | 0x67 | UUID de proximidade 15º byte | UUID do usuário |
| 24 | 0x20 | UUID de proximidade 16º byte | UUID do usuário |
| 25 | AA | 1º byte principal | Valor principal |
| 26 | BB | 2º byte principal | Valor principal |
| 27 | CC | 1º byte menor | Valor menor |
| 28 | CC | 2º byte menor | Valor menor |
| 29 | 0xB3 | Potência do sinal (SSI calibrado a 1 m) | Valor da potência do sinal |
| 30 | Nível da bateria | Bnível da bateria | Bnível da bateria |
Configurando o Lansitec BLE Beacon com um iPhone #
Aviso: todos os parâmetros estão em codificação hexadecimal.
Passo 1: Pesquise e baixe “LightBlue” na App Store.

Passo 2: Pressione longamente o botão para ligar o Etiqueta de farol B002. Uma luz vermelha pisca no primeiro minuto.
Etapa 3: Abrir Azul claroe clique em um beacon com o nome “LS_Beacon_Vx.x”, que será exibido no aplicativo. Clique no iBeacon dentro de 1 minuto após ligá-lo, ou ele deverá ser reiniciado para entrar no modo de configuração novamente.
![]()
Configuração principal #


- Clique em “Principal” (passo 1).
- Clique em “Escrever novo valor” (etapa 2).
- Insira um novo valor (etapa 3) e clique em “Concluído” (etapa 4) para salvar e clique em “0xFFF2” (etapa 5) para retornar à página “Principal”.
- O novo valor é exibido no bloco de valores (etapa 6) da página "Principal", e o valor anterior fica em cinza. Clique em "LS_Beacon_V8.3" (etapa 7) para retornar à página anterior.
- Clique em “Voltar” (passo 8) para sair da configuração. Caso contrário, a alteração NÃO será salva.
Configure “UUID”, “Menor”, “Intervalo”, “Potência_TX”, “Tempo do Acelerômetro” e “Tempo do Anúncio” da mesma forma. Saia do LightBlue após a configuração. A luz para de piscar após a configuração.
Configuração de anúncio de nível de bateria #


- Clique em “Anúncio de nível de bateria” (etapa 1).
- Clique em “Escrever novo valor” (etapa 2).
- Inserir o valor "00" significa desabilitar a função de anúncio do nível da bateria, e "01" significa habilitar esta função (etapa 3). Clique em "Concluído" (etapa 4) para salvar e clique em "0xFFF8" (etapa 5) para retornar à página "Anúncio do Nível da Bateria".
- O novo valor é mostrado no bloco de valores (etapa 6) da página “Anúncio de nível de bateria”, e o valor anterior fica cinza.
- Clique em "LS_Beacon_V8.3" (passo 7) para retornar à página anterior. Em seguida, saia da configuração. Caso contrário, a alteração NÃO será salva.
Configure "Anúncio de 24 horas sem movimento" da mesma forma. Saia do LightBlue após a configuração. A luz para de piscar após a configuração.
Também podemos pré-programar o “UUID”, “Principal”, “Secundário”, “Intervalo”, “Potência TX”, “Tempo do acelerômetro”, “Hora do anúncio”, “Anúncio do nível da bateria” e “Anúncio de 24 horas sem movimento” para você e imprimi-los na caixa antes do envio.
Etiqueta de farol Bluetooth B002 com duração da bateria #
Tabela 9: Duração da bateria (com o sensor de aceleração)
| Intervalo de transmissão (ms) | 100 | 500 | 1000 | 5000 |
| Corrente média (μA) | 154 | 33.8 | 17 | 5 |
| Duração da bateria (mês) | 3 | 15 | 29 | 104 |
Tabela 10: Duração da bateria (sem o sensor de aceleração)
| Intervalo de transmissão (ms) | 100 | 500 | 1000 | 5000 |
| Corrente média (μA) | 153 | 33 | 16 | 4.2 |
| Duração da bateria (mês) | 3 | 15 | 31 | 124 |
Observação:
Em relação à precisão, vários fatores influenciam a precisão das medições de distância com BLE RSSI.
- Efeito de sombra: os sinais podem ser refletidos por paredes e vidros muitas vezes durante a transmissão. DA fração altera o caminho do sinal. Isso resulta em recebimento de intensidade de sinal instável.
- Existem muitos dispositivos com 2.4G, Wi-Fi, Bluetooth e Zigbee. O sinal pode se sobrepor, tornando a intensidade do sinal recebido instável.
- Due to the semiconductor manufacturing limitation, Potência TX is not stable.
Ao usar um beacon para posicionamento, considere o seguinte método para medir a distância.
- Enquanto o beacon estiver anunciando, colete amostras repetidamente do RSSI a uma distância de 1 metro por no mínimo 10 segundos.
- Descarte os 10% mais altos das amostras RSSI.
- Descarte o menor 20% das amostras RSSI.
- Calcule a média das amostras restantes para obter o valor da Potência Medida.
Recomendamos outros dois algoritmos para calcular a distância e a posição:
- Algoritmo de média móvel, documento Lansitec número 930-00171.
- Calibração de posição, documento Lansitec número 930-00172.
Como instalar uma etiqueta de farol Bluetooth B002 #

Rasgue a fita adesiva dupla face traseira e cole-a onde quiser.

Embalagem #
Embalagem em lote

Embalagem de amostra

Informações sobre pedidos #
| Descrição | PN |
| Etiqueta BLE, ibeacon, 320mAh | 100-0B002 |